    The narrative is acquainted: Revolutionary expertise arrives, promising to liberate ladies from home drudgery {and professional} constraints. The electrical oven would free housewives from coal-burning stoves. The washer would eradicate laundry day. The microwave would make meal preparation easy. But as historian Ruth Schwartz Cowan argued in her landmark ebook, More Work for Mother, these improvements didn’t scale back ladies’s workload. They merely shifted expectations, creating new requirements of cleanliness and comfort that usually meant extra work, not much less.

    So once we converse of AI as the answer to skilled and private burdens, skepticism is warranted. In any case, expertise has repeatedly promised liberation whereas delivering new types of constraint. The query isn’t whether or not AI will change skilled and private work; it’s whether or not this alteration will lastly favor ladies’s autonomy reasonably than merely reorganizing their obligations.

    Latest knowledge Duckbill collected alongside Harris Ballot reveals that 47% of ladies keep away from asking for assist to stop burdening others. This hesitation displays not simply conditioning round self-sacrifice, however hard-won knowledge about technological guarantees that not often materialize as marketed.
